Walter Hundley Chandler, 65, passed away Tuesday, September 27, 2022 at his home in Onancock, VA. Born February 12, 1957 in Onancock, he was the son of the late John Roland Chandler and Sue Hundley Chandler.
Following high school, Walt attended the University of Richmond, where he met Victoria “Vicky” Hilbush, the love of his life whom he later married and returned to the Shore. As an Eastern Shore native with roots tracing back to the 1630’s, Walt was among many in his lineage who were drawn to the Chesapeake Bay and maritime interests, including boatbuilding. In a recent article by the Eastern Shore Post chronicling Walt’s building his fifth wooden Chesapeake deadrise, he shared about his 43-year career as a master carpenter and woodworker but followed-up by simply saying “boats are my love.” He loved his family, was passionate in crafting wood with his talented hands, and loved being on the water and the serenity that provided.
